1 Jital - Bull & Horse - Anangapala - Tomaras in Delhi
Country: Tomara dynasty
(Indian states and kingdoms)
Denomination: 1 Jital
(1)
Year: (1130-1145)
Material: Billon
Weight: 3.4 g
Shape: Round
Diameter: 15 mm
Type: Common coin
Catalog list: tomara dynastyindian states and kingdoms
Description:
Obverse
Recumbent bull facing left, club-like trisula (trident) symbol on the rump. Left and above,Nagari Sri Samanta Deva above
Reverse
Rider bearing lance on caprisoned horse facing right, with three dots of harness on horse's rump. Left and right, Devanagari legend
